Meta's data portability tools allow users to create transfer requests on Meta's platforms through the Export Your Information (EYI) tool, which provide users granular control over which data is transferred, how often it is transferred, and where it is being transferred to. In most cases this is the preferred user experience, however, there are situations where the user experience is improved by initiating the data transfer using information collected on your platform. These use cases are supported by the Export Your Information (EYI) tool support for Deep Linking, which you can use to create a custom link with some or all options in the tool pre-selected.
Deep links for EYI must direct users to the Facebook or Instagram Accounts Center EYI page - https://accountscenter.facebook.com/info_and_permissions/dyi, or https://accountscenter.instagram.com/info_and_permissions/dyi.
You can specify options to pre-select in the query parameters of the URL, described by the table below.
